About
Kairo is a research workbench for LLM inference on NVIDIA Blackwell GPUs that measures specific workloads (such as CUDA Graph replay versus eager execution for NVFP4 serving on an RTX 5090) and only promotes exact, measured workload configurations into a fail-closed runtime routing policy. It is explicitly not a general-purpose inference engine and does not replace vLLM, CUTLASS, or cuBLAS.
Why it made the leaderboard
It gives LLM infra engineers a reproducible, evidence-gated methodology for deciding when CUDA Graph replay actually helps NVFP4 inference throughput instead of guessing.
